Society will collapse in days...and that's the good news.
Former special ops and survivalist Simon Redfall has lost everything: his wife, his fortune, and his future. Despite being hunted by angry mobs and his own bankrupt government, Simon arrives in Washington, DC, to attend the first ever pay-per-view execution of someone he loves.
Then red storm clouds appear and begin to spread their potentially toxic rain across the planet. The mysterious weather phenomenon grounds all travelers, knocks out communications, and threatens to take down the grid, sending civilization back to the Stone Age.
As society tumbles into chaos, Simon joins a group of like-minded preppers to unlock the secrets behind a terrifying global conspiracy. What he and his band of freedom fighters soon learn will put their lives - and the lives of everyone else on the planet - at risk.
For humanity, time is running out.... When the red rain stops falling, it will be too late to stop what's coming next.

We start with seeing Simon Redfall at his wife's execution. She is being put to death for terrorism. He is in disguise so no one knows who he is. The execution is a major event that has the feel f a carnival! It's also televised. Simons wife maintains her innocence right up to the end, and Simon suffers through it, never quite believing she did what she is accused of, but also wondering how is she innocent? He tries to leave quietly but is recognised by a reporter, angry people turn and start chasing him. He runs but is trapped when suddenly red rain starts falling, the crowd is distracted when a van with some kids come and save him. What follows is a plot of mystery, intrigue subterfuge and the lengths people go to to win.
Character wise, this has a lot of different ones but they were all well written and developed. I particularly liked the group of youths that have the compound in the Amish country called Pandora. It's refreshing to have a book that has young people as preppers and not just the adults. These kids are also incredibly smart and capable. They know there's a conspiracy afoot and are willing to do what's needed to uncover the truth, the first being finding Simon Redfall!!
The author has definitely captured my attention with this book. It sets the scene for what seems to be an amazing series. He has created a unique an addictive book and one that will bring you on a roller coaster, edge of your seat ride! One thing though, be warned that this ends in a major cliff hanger, not even a cliff hanger per say, it kinda just ... ends! We are warned about it at the start, but it still feels abrupt. Yet despite me not liking cliff hangers, I didn't mind this because it has made me want book 2 even more. I've become invested in this story and can't wait to see where it goes.
This is the first book I've listened to being read by Gary Tiedemann and it won't be the last. He was so easy to listen to and really brought the story to life. He had plenty of distinct tones for each character and knew when to bring the extra tenseness needed to make it thoroughly enjoyable.
